No, not really but there are twenty states with submissions on the White House website that are asking to leave the union peacefully and begin their own government. Only one has the required number of signatures for an answer - Texas. No answer has been issued as yet.

There are more than 20 states that have voted on or have on the docket a vote on secession. Texas has it in their constitution - they can leave anytime.

No Geland,

The US FEDERAL government is strong because States rights were pushed aside for a Federalist system at the end of the American Civil War, which ended the question if the United States was still a union of states or they were a Federalist country.

They went from being similar to the EU, to being any other Federalist country such as Germany, where the Federal Government ends up being the supreme law of the land regardless of what its individual states really want or not.

Secession in the US is as dead as Elvis Presley, sure some people keep the dream and hope alive, but for practicality's sake, its all but dead and gone.
